Nitrogen Dioxide (NO2) Sensor P/N 718
Data Sheet
Sensor Features
• Reliable solid state metal oxide technology
• Rugged, long lasting sensor
• Large dynamic range
• Tolerates a wide range of temperature, pressure and humidity levels
• Low cost
Performance Characteristics
Nominal Range
0 to >200 ppm
Maximum Overload
TBD
Expected Operating Life
>5 years
Output Signal (Rair)
5-10 \£l
Output Signal R10 ppm
Approx. 150 k£i
Temperature Range
-40°C to + I00°C minimum
T50 Response Time
Approx. 30 seconds
T90 Response Time
<90 seconds
Relative Humidity Range
0 to 99 % non-condensing
Long Term Output Drift
TBD
Average Repeatability
± 15%
Output Characteristic
Logarithmic
